java 生成短链接怎么操作?
首先,我们需要在虾果中创建一个短链接。在虾果的“管理”页面中,点击“生成短链接”,选择“从应用中生成”,然后选择要生成的短链接应用,点击“开始生成”即可。
在生成的短链接中,我们可以根据需求设置链接的文本、图片、速度等属性,同时也可以设置短链接的分享链接、下载链接等属性。
下面,我们将以Java操作虾果工具为例,介绍如何生成短链接。
1. 导入虾果库
首先,我们需要导入虾果库,可以使用以下代码导入:
```java
import org.runoob.core.api.App;
import org.runoob.core.api.Web;
import org.runoob.core.api.model.User;
import org.runoob.core.util.java.JavaUtil;
public class Runoob {
public static void main(String[] args) {
// 导入虾果库
JavaUtil.init();
// 创建应用实例
App app = App.create("com.runoob.app");
// 创建Web实例
Web web = Web.create("runoob.web");
// 创建用户实例
User user = User.create("user123");
// 创建短链接
String url = user.getUrl();
Web.write(url, "html");
}
}
```
2. 获取短链接地址
在虾果中,我们可以通过用户属性获取短链接地址,可以使用以下代码获取:
```java
public static String getUrl(User user) {
// 获取用户对象
JavaUtil.init();
UserUtil.checkUser(user);
// 获取短链接地址
String url = user.getUrl();
JavaUtil.log(url);
return url;
}
```
其中,JavaUtil.init() 可以调用虾果库的初始化方法,JavaUtil.checkUser() 可以检查用户属性是否正确,JavaUtil.log() 可以输出短链接地址等信息。
3. 将短链接分享或下载
在虾果中,我们可以通过分享或下载链接将短链接分享或下载到其他应用或浏览器中。可以使用以下代码将短链接分享或下载到其他应用或浏览器中:
```java
public static void share(String url, String fileName) {
// 获取分享对象
User user = User.create("user123");
Web.write(url, fileName, "png");
}
public static void download(String url, String fileName) {
// 获取下载对象
User user = User.create("user123");
Web.write(url, fileName, "pdf");
}
```
其中,分享或下载链接可以使用不同的文件格式,如图片格式、pdf格式等。
以上就是Java操作虾果工具生成短链接的基本操作,希望对您有所帮助。
推荐阅读
相关推荐
图文阅读
-
营销推广网有哪些优势?线上推广方式有哪些?
2024-12-11导语: 随着互联网的不断发展,线上推广已成为企业营销的重要手段。如何选择合适的线上推广工具,提高推广...
推广用户微信企业 -
如何实现二维码转链接?社群营销是一种基于什么的营销模式?
2024-12-11导语: 社群营销作为当下流行的营销模式,其核心在于通过微信群、QQ群等社群平台,将用户聚集在一起,进...
营销社群用户链接二维码 -
有哪些好用的短链在线生成器?品牌推广公司怎么运营?
2024-12-11导语:随着互联网的快速发展,品牌推广和营销成为企业生存的关键。如何高效引流、精准触达目标用户成为众多...
微信用户 -
营销推广精准需要注意什么?电商公司怎么运营?
2024-12-11导语:随着互联网的快速发展,营销推广成为企业获取流量、提升品牌知名度和销售额的重要手段。然而,如何精...
用户营销企业运营公司 -
网络推广怎么做?餐饮引流的最快方法是什么?
2024-12-11网络推广怎么做?餐饮引流的最快方法是什么?在竞争激烈的餐饮行业中,如何高效地进行网络推广和引流,是每...
推广餐饮用户微信营销 -
有哪些好用的二维码制作生成器?线上推广怎么做?
2024-12-11导语: 在线上推广过程中,二维码制作生成器是必不可少的工具。它能帮助我们快速生成各种类型的二维码,实...
二维码推广制作生成器功能